Abstract-thenbsreference flat pulse generator (rfpg)is usedtotransferdcvoltageandresistancestandardstothenanosecond domain. Thetransition durationis 600ps,andall perturbationsaredampedouttoless than ±10mvwithin5ns.

A pulse-forming network (pfn) is an electric circuit that accumulates electrical energy over a comparatively long time, and then releases the stored energy in the form of a relatively square pulse of comparatively brief duration for various pulsed power applications.
Hp 8082a pulse generator the hp 8082a is from 1974, but you would not know it from its specs. It offers pulses down to 2 ns with 1 ns rise time up to 250 mhz repetition rate. More over, both the leading and trailing edge rise times are independently adjustable.

Pulse position modulation is defined as a process of varying the position of the signal pulse, by taking the reference signal, in accordance to the modulating signal variations. The amplitude and width of the pulse remains constant for ppm signals.
A local calibraion lab had a half-dozeon of these pulse generators on ebay. What a reference flat pulse generort does is take and input pulse train, and output a pulse train that goes fron 1 volt to ground. But when it drops to ground it does so with very little ringing or undershoot.
